gnawed
英 [nɔːd]
美 [nɔːd]
v. 咬; 啃; 啮
gnaw的过去分词和过去式
柯林斯词典
- VERB 咬;啃;啮
If people or animalsgnawsomething orgnaw atit, they bite it repeatedly.- Woodlice attack living plants and gnaw at the stems...
木虱会侵害活体植物并啃咬它们的茎。 - Melanie gnawed a long, painted fingernail.
梅拉妮咬着涂过指甲油的长指甲。
- Woodlice attack living plants and gnaw at the stems...
- VERB 折磨;使不安
If a feeling or thoughtgnaws atyou, it causes you to keep worrying.- Doubts were already gnawing away at the back of his mind...
心底的疑团已经开始困扰他。 - Mary Ann's exhilaration gave way to gnawing fear.
玛丽·安从欣喜若狂变得忧惧不安。
- Doubts were already gnawing away at the back of his mind...
